A driver escaped a car fire without injury. Danbury firefighters responded to Ball Pond Road around 4 o'clock yesterday afternoon and found the car fully engulfed in flames. Ball Pond Volunteer Fire Company out of New Fairfield also responded and quickly extinguished the blaze. The state Department of Energy and Environmental Protection was called to the scene because of fluids that spilled from the vehicle and the runoff from knocking down the fire. The Danbury Fire Marshals Office is investigating the cause of the fire which is undetermined at this time.
